SB00510, titled 'An Act Concerning Project Oceanology At Avery Point', focuses on maintaining funding levels for Project Oceanology, an educational initiative based at Avery Point. This project plays a vital role in marine science education and aims to engage students in hands-on learning experiences related to the ocean and environmental sciences. By securing funding, the bill seeks to ensure the continuation and enhancement of such programs, which are essential for fostering future scientists and promoting awareness about marine ecosystems.
